Frequently Asked Questions about Winter Park
How much are Studio apartments in Winter Park?
There are currently 89 Studio Apartments in Winter Park with rent ranges from $900 to $2,468 with an average price of $1,524.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Winter Park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Winter Park ranges from $903 to $3,665 with an average monthly rent of $1,787.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Winter Park c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Winter Park range from $976 to $5,767.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,107.
How expensive are Winter Park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 103 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Winter Park on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,099 to $7,384 - averaging $2,707 for the location.
